I have also been facing this problem for a long time. It began with
12.04LTS as I remember. Previously the system was stable as a rock
running 10.04 LTS.

Tried to re-install the OS from scratch, but still facing the problem.
Changed Video card, main board. Swapping RAM tried different graphics
drivers, different available kernels but there is still random freezing.
Could not effort to change the $1000 CPU...

To me it happens most often when kicking on a link in Thunderbird to be
opened in Firefox. Complete freeze, but the mice some times still moves
around. No response from keyboard at all (numloc and capsloc LEDs does
not change). Some times the system freeze when running in idle, and I
discover this at logon screen. Normal uptime is about two three days
between forced HW reboots.

The strange about this bug is, that my kids runs a PC Intel Core i7-3770
3,4GHz Asrock/Gigabyte B75-Chipset mATX without facing any problem at
all.  I'm also user on the PC, running Gnome classic and compiz. I never
log out, just switch user. It only reboots when applying new packages
that requires a reboot, els its always running stable.


Current configuration facing this problem:

uptime 12:57:54 up 1 day,  2:22
  
Gnome Classic + Compiz
Linux-x86_64
Intel(R) Core(TM) i7-3960X CPU @ 3.30GHz
Kernel 3.8.0-34-generic
NVIDIA GTX760 Driver Version: 319.32
/dev/sda  Samsung SSD 840
16 GB Main Memory
MB Rampage IV Extreme
